As @cjm61 noted, virtually all QVC food products have a Nutritional Information PDF file link in their listings that provides ingredients and nutrition details. I have occasionally encountered new products that do not yet have this link, but many items have photos of the ingredient list or nutrition panel that you can review. If none of this is available, simply contact customer service or the social team; it's an extra step that shouldn't be needed, but the one time I tried it for a non-food item that didn't list its components, my request was expedited and the information was posted within 48 hours.
